•When using DVI-HDMI conversion cable (INPUT1):
G3.5 mm stereo minijack cable
DVI-HDMIconversion cable
• When using a DVI-HDMI conversion cable, you should make an analog audio connection. Inthis case,
in addition to connecting a DVI-HDMI conversion cable to the INPUT 1(HDMI) terminal, connect a
© 3.5 mm stereo minijack cable to the AUDIO PC/HDMI terminal.
